Hunrarahi

Hunrarahi is a village located in Pakribarawan subdivision of Nawada district in Bihar, India. It is situated 7km away from sub-district headquarter Pakribarawan (tehsildar office) and 21km away from district headquarter Nawada. As per 2009 stats, Poksi is the gram panchayat of Hunrarahi village.

About Hunrarahi

According to Census 2011, the location code or village code of Hunrarahi is 257681. The village spans a total geographical area of 72 hectares. Nawada is nearest town to Hunrarahi village for all major economic activities, which is approximately 21km away.

Population of Hunrarahi

Below is a concise population overview of Hunrarahi as per the Census 2011 data. The table highlights the key population metrics categorized by gender and social groups.

ParticularsTotalMaleFemale
Total Population 337 174 163
Child Population (0–6 yrs) 63 40 23
Scheduled Castes (SC) N/A N/A N/A
Scheduled Tribes (ST) N/A N/A N/A
Literate Population 234 129 105
Illiterate Population 103 45 58

Here's a detailed summary of the Basic Population Details of Hunrarahi village:

  • The total population of Hunrarahi village is around 337, including approximately 174 males and 163 females, with a sex ratio of 936 females per 1,000 males.
  • There are about 63 children aged 0–6 years in Hunrarahi village, reflecting the young population in the village.
  • The literacy rate of Hunrarahi village is about 69.44%, with male literacy at 74.14% and female literacy at 64.42%.
  • There are around 48 households in Hunrarahi village.

Connectivity of Hunrarahi

Connectivity plays a major role in improving access, opportunities, and overall development of villages like Hunrarahi. As per the 2011 stats, Hunrarahi had access to public bus service, private bus service and railway station.

Connectivity Type Status (in year 2011)
Public Bus Service Available within 10+ km distance
Private Bus Service Available within 10+ km distance
Railway Station Available within 10+ km distance
